- Q4// An open gas turbine plant works between the fixed absolute temperature limits 300K and 1500K, thẻ absolute pressure limits being 1bar and 14bar. The isentropic efficiency of compresso" is 0.85 and that of turbine is 0.86. Estimate the actual thermal efficiency of the plant and the power developed. The calorific value of fuel is 4200kJ/kg. Assume neombustor 0.99, Nmech0.98 for whole assembly, ngen=0.985, and air mass flow rate is 500kg/s. [Hint: (ma+ m)hz - mahz = m, x C. V.x Ncombustor]
